Bailey & Glasser LLP

Mark Boyko is a seasoned litigator at Bailey & Glasser LLP, maintaining a national practice focused on ERISA and fiduciary breach litigation. He advises clients across various industries, with particular expertise in cases involving 401(k) plans and ESOPs at privately held companies. His work includes significant settlements and complex multi-party disputes, often involving allegations of fiduciary misconduct. Notably, Boyko has secured two victories before the US Supreme Court, underscoring his expertise in high-stakes retirement plan litigation.

Brown & James

Steven Schwartz is a senior litigator at Brown & James with a long-standing practice focused on commercial disputes across the Midwest. His work spans economic loss claims, insurance coverage, employment discrimination defense, and select intellectual property matters. Schwartz regularly represents clients in complex, high-value cases, including multi-million-dollar insurance disputes and legal malpractice claims, and has recent experience handling cyber liability matters involving data breaches and class actions.
